Transaction 4a58dd61d73632cd3de3250be79b93f37f43cdd9dec80e406a53cd74536037ff

1 Input
2 Outputs
  • 4a58dd61d73632cd3de3250be79b93f37f43cdd9dec80e406a53cd74536037ff:0
  • value  5000000
    address  3NC4wB7Lt5KRiUo4CtA5BHtsdCNZ1csodX
  • 4a58dd61d73632cd3de3250be79b93f37f43cdd9dec80e406a53cd74536037ff:1
  • value  45532745
    address  bc1q28svy83r59mm97tdzt98f5ls5gdz0vpwzwknyj